BACARDI UNIVERSITY MIX 2016 EPILOGUE



Last February 27, 2016, we held the recently concluded Bacardi UMIX Bartending Challenge for University Students at Café Enye in Eastwood City in Libis, Quezon City. This event was attended by different Hotel and Restaurant Management schools from Metro Manila, Cavite and Baguio. As the event commenced at 2pm the place will filled with students, teachers, guests, and an overflowing Cuba Libre for everyone to enjoy,

Now on its 3rd year, this competition was set up in order for us to develop the students who aspire to be future bartenders and eventually join the Bacardi Legacy Global Competition which is incidentally is on its first year here in our country. The format of this competition still uses the “Talking Bartender” where each will make an original cocktail while explaining it to the audience.This event is the culminating activity of the Bacardi University Tour held last September.

To help with finding out this year’s champion, the event had the following panel of judges:

Adrian Gearing from Holland America Line Training Center, Azrael Colladilla , a prominent blogger, Mark Tolentino of Revel Bar and one of the top 5 finalists of Bacardi Legacy, Mark Bernandino of Scarlet Bar and on of the top 5 finalists of Bacardi Legacy, and Ito Zamora, Bacardi Philippines representative.

The competition was pretty tight since all of the participants gave their all. Each had a story to tell based on their personal experience. Each cocktail was well thought of with each ingredient having an explanation. The judges had a tough time deliberating but finally were able to come up with the winners.



The Bacardi UMIX Bartending Competition for Students 2016 winners are:


First Place – John Anthony Caballes( Lyceum of the Philippines Manila)

Second Place- Charmaine Dela Paz (Lyceum of the Philippines Manila)

Third Place – Jane Dianne Nabung (University of the Cordilleras)



Best in Cocktail and Best in Presentation

Princess Elayza Jayne R. Co (University of Santo Tomas)


The top placers all received cash prizes and Bartending kits courtesy of Bacardi Philippines.
